Rainy.
Luther and Kang stood on the castle helipad, watching the transport plane slowly descend from the sky.
The transport plane was silent and highly maneuverable, and was obviously the anti-gravity aircraft from the White Knight.
When the gates rose, Luther saw Varis first.
"Chief Think Tank." Luther stepped forward and exchanged the Sky Eagle salute with Varis.
Varis was as cold as ever, turning to look inside the transport plane.
Some mortal workers accompanied by construction machinery escorted down a sharp monument-like object.
Luther went forward to examine the monument.
The material used to make this thing is crystal. Luther had seen this kind of crystal on some people in the White Knight Think Tank. They would use this crystal to power their own think tank model Terminator Tactical Dreadnought.
I heard that this crystal came from the Lord of the White Knight, who created the crystal and infused it with his own psychic power... As an outsider, Luther only knew this.
The crystal monument is about 19 meters tall and is shaped like a triangle.
The stele is engraved with dense text.
"A kind of Nuceria language?" Luther looked at Varis with a smile, "I have learned the language of the Nuceria people, but I still can't understand these words."
"This is the language of the Lord of the White Knights himself." Varis looked down at the characters on the inscription. "This language is used for internal communication within the think tank."
Hearing this, Luther turned to look at Kang.
Kang silently looked at the words on the crystal tablet, but his attention was not there at all.
As a Dark Watcher, Kang could see Qin Xia's idea of ordering the think tank to build these crystal tablets.
These crystal tablets are actually a kind of ritual hub, and some words are used on them to play some metaphysical role.
For example, there is a sentence in those inscriptions: "Forever suppress the snake that bites its tail."
These are the words Qin Xia ordered his people to engrave. He will tell the think tanks that the words I taught you have a magical power. The think tanks will believe so, and then the words engraved by them will really have mysterious power and play some role in suppressing the Ouroboros.
If this text was engraved by an ordinary person instead of a psychic, it would be just like "Blessings to you", which would be of no use other than sounding nice.
"We have built three hundred and thirty-three of these crystal monuments," Varis said. "Lord Caliban, you must plan an operation that will allow us to deploy three hundred and thirty-three crystal monuments across the wasteland."
"Why three hundred and thirty-three?" Luther asked.
"The Lord of the White Knights likes the number three." Varis told the truth.
After hearing this answer, Luther felt that Varys was trying to fool him. In his opinion, a truly true answer should be: the number three involves Caliban, and its own meaning is also extraordinary.
But that doesn't matter much.
"I have made all the preparations." Luther told the Chief Think Tank his plan. "There are about 10,000 Dark Angels on Caliban. I will lead them to go deep into the wasteland with you. No mortal will participate in this operation..."
"Do not."
At this point, Luther changed his mind because he suddenly remembered one thing, that is, Kavak, who was undercover among the evil believers, and Kavak's like-minded people.
The willpower of these people is unusually strong.
Kavak will be used in some things in the future.
"I will also involve some mortals with extremely strong willpower in the action," Luther said.
Varis remained silent.
Luther looked at Varis, waiting for the chief think tank's response.
After silence lasted for a few seconds, Kang on the side spoke up: "The Lord of the White Knights has already told his subordinates that your opinion is the most important from now on, so the Chief Think Tank will not express his opinion."
Hearing these words full of trust, Luther smiled slightly and saluted the Chief Think Tank: "I will make sure everything goes well."
"How much time do you need to prepare?" Varis asked coldly.
"I'm ready and can go now," said Luther.
When Varis heard that they could set off now, he was stunned for a moment, because in his opinion, if he wanted to mobilize more than 10,000 Space Marines to a dangerous place like the wasteland, it would certainly require extremely complicated preparations.
In order to not worry Varis, Luther explained: "In fact, I started making preparations when the Lord of the White Knights left the castle, because I thought there might be a war in the wasteland, and some terrible existence would appear and we would need to mobilize the army to fight against it... The war will not happen, but the various mobilizations I made in advance can still come in handy."
After hearing this explanation, Varis looked at Luther with admiration in his eyes.

Unlike Qin Xia and Kang when they went deep into the wilderness, the large army led by Luther used something called "Colossus" when they went deep into the wilderness.
The full name of the Colossus is "Colossus Command Vehicle/Command Hall".
All the materials, supplies, and participants needed to carry out the ritual operations are concentrated in this command vehicle.
The vehicle is ninety meters high, and from a distance it looks like a mountain moving across the mountains of Caliban that intercept the cold currents of the northern wasteland. "Colossus command vehicle."
On the command deck, Varis looked out the window at the complex terrain that the Colossus was crushing like flat ground, and turned to look at Luther.
"Your First Legion's recruitment world actually has a Colossus command vehicle."
Hearing the Chief Think Tank's sigh, the Dark Angels who were discussing specific matters around the tactical table simply raised their heads, then lowered their heads and continued talking.
Luther said to Varis, "The First Legion is not so wealthy that it would allocate a command vehicle to its own recruiting world."
“Then this command vehicle was coordinated to Caliban by you when you left the Legion,” Varis guessed.
"Haha." Luther smiled and shook his head, "Not really. This command vehicle was paralyzed during the Second Randan War. The Legion reported it to Mars, and Mars sent two more, and then repaired this paralyzed Colossus."
"The Primarch felt that the Colossus was too big and that it might have hidden problems that had not been discovered and repaired after being paralyzed by the explosion. It would be bad if the command vehicle that was supposed to carry the command level had a problem, so he asked me to arrange this paralyzed command vehicle on my own."
At this point, Luther pointed his index finger at the panoramic view of the wasteland on the tactical table and said, "I brought it to Caliban."
Varis frowned.
Although he had seen with his own eyes how wealthy the First Legion was, he had never expected that a Colossus command vehicle could be replaced with two if one broke down...
When the 12th Legion had not yet welcomed back its primarch, it was extremely poor.
But fortunately, many things got better afterwards because of the return of the Primarch. The XII Legion had Numata and many industrial worlds of Greater Nuceria as sources of logistical supply, and there were also enough knight mechas to distribute to each chapter.
"Sir." A dark angel came over with a cup of hot water and handed it to Varis.
After Varis took the cup of water, the dark angel carried the tray to the tactical table and distributed the remaining hot water.
Since Luther chose not to bring mortal servants, the ones delivering water now were Astartes.
"Two options." Luther raised his head after exchanging a few words with the surrounding Dark Angels and said to Varis, "The first option is that we take the command vehicle to the deployment locations of the crystal monuments pointed out by the Lord of the White Knights, and then the command will be handed over to your think tank. In this way, we will rush to one location after another together."
"The second option is to divide the troops into several routes. Your White Knight's think tank should also divide the troops into several routes. The advantage of this method is that it is fast."
After listening to Luther, Varis chose the second option without hesitation.
"I also tend to lean towards the second option." Luther then began to plan.
The command vehicle continued to move across the wasteland.
Varis suddenly heard a Dark Angel driving a command vehicle loudly report: "We have found traces of suspected human activity ahead... They are not zombies from the Eco-City."
"Are you sure?" Luther asked, "The Northern Wasteland. You are from Caliban. You should know how absurd it is to have traces of human activity in this place."
The Dark Angel shrugged, then nodded.
"Then..." Luther suddenly hesitated, his eyes became deep, and after pondering for a few seconds, he shook his head, "Don't worry, just keep going."
The Colossus command vehicle continued to move forward in the snow and ice.
A pile of broken stone walls, a still burning bonfire, some photos, some food... everything on the road in front of the command vehicle was crushed by this magnificent man-made giant like a mountain.
Only Kang, in the shadows of the command deck, knew who had left these things, and what had lived among them.
After a moment, Luther ordered the command vehicle to stop.
The giant slid over the wasteland for more than a hundred meters before slowly stopping.
The Dark Angels prepared themselves in the various chambers at the base of the Colossus.
When Luther's order was passed down again, the Dark Angels in the cabin stood up in unison, put on their helmets, and turned on the safety of their bolters.
Red lights flashed in all the cabins, and then the cabin floor slowly fell down, sank out from the bottom of the Colossus and landed steadily.
When the Dark Angels left the Colossus, the White Knights' think tank assigned to them was already in place.
Like Qin Xia, these White Knight think tanks use psychic power to control a knight mecha, with a crystal tablet mounted on the back of the knight mecha.
Qin Xia once taught the think tanks how to control unmanned war machines like himself. He called this psychic spell that allowed the think tanks to work part-time as knights or Titan drivers "puppetry".
The think tanks accompanied the Dark Angels, who were divided into thirty groups, to various deployment locations. The superhuman warriors moved extremely quickly, rushing in all directions at the maximum speed that their strong bodies could burst out.
A task that might take a mortal a year or two to complete can now be completed in just a few days by an Astartes.
"Chief Think Tank, look back at the command vehicle." Luther walked from the tactical table to the place where Varis had just stood, looking out the window at Varis' figure standing on a knight mech and driving it to run.
As the chief think tank, Varis also had to personally accompany a team of Dark Angels to deploy the crystal monument.
The White Knights are few in number.
"If you White Knights had a Colossus, how would you use it?" Luther said in the communication channel.
"Use it as you do." Varis glanced at the towering giant.
"Yes." Luther nodded slowly, "Then this Colossus and the priests who maintain it will all be yours. It will be sent to a cruiser afterwards."
